What Is A Multifamily Property

How to buy your first multi family investment property.

To put it simply, a multifamily home is any residential property that features more than one housing unit.

These could be duplexes, triplexes, fourplexes, apartment complexes, or really anything that involves multiple tenants living in occupied units on one property. Owners can live in any of these units as well, which would make it an owner-occupied propertysomething we call house hacking, which is typically done with residential multifamily properties with two, three, or four total units.

Properties with more than four units are deemed commercial, while four and below are deemed residential. This distinction is important for lending purposes, as the lending rules for residential multifamily differ from the lending rules for commercial investments.

In addition to the lending distinction, larger multifamily properties may also have different methods for finding, analyzing, financing, and managing the property. For this reason, most investors getting into multifamily start with small residential properties and move into the larger multifamily deals once theyve gained some experience.

What Are The Different Kinds Of Multi

If youre interested in investing in real estate, its good to know the different types of multi-family homes on the market. Multi-family properties with 2-4 units are often referred to as residential multi-family. Properties with 5 or more units are commercial multi-family, require more upfront capital, and are subject to different requirements for financing and taxes.

For the purposes of this article, well be discussing residential multi-family as an investment strategy. To keep it simple, we will use the term multi-family to refer to properties with 2-4 units.

A Quick Estimate Of Repairs Needed

Overall, the property was in pretty good shape. It looked pretty ugly from the outside . It definitely needed a new paint job on the outside, and some of the shingles from a fairly new roof had blown off in a freak windstorm we had several years back . Additionally, the fifth unit needed some help to bring it into a rentable shape. I estimated about $10,000 worth of work to get the place fully finished, including finishing up the fifth unit.

Immediately, I recalculated my numbers based on the new unit that I could eventually get rented out. As it turned out, it looked like this:

  • Units 1-4 Rent: $450 each x 4 = $1,800
  • Unit 5: $600
  • Mortgage at $100,000: $550/month
  • Mortgage at $90,000: $470/month
  • Mortgage at $80,000: $430/month

Remember, these numbers are based on having no money downso they are far above my threshold.

Close On The Property

In my state, we close real estate transactions with title companies, though in some states, you might use an attorney. Either way, the process is pretty much the same.

Lets do a quick re-cap:

  • I found the property online.
  • I did a quick, five-minute analysis of it.
  • I walked through the property quickly.
  • I offered on the property.
  • I negotiated on the property and finally agreed on terms.
  • I inspected the property.
  • I arranged financing.

At this point, I was ready to proceed. My real estate agent sent over the purchase and sale agreement to the title company, and the title company went to work. It took about a week or so to finish the process, where they did a title search and prepared all the documents, including the promissory note and deed of trust between me and the private lender. I arranged for insurance and made an appointment to sign the documents.

Then I closed on the property. As an added bonus, the property management company who was looking after the place before closing actually found a tenant for the fourth unit before closing, so I inherited the property completely full .

Whats The Difference Between A 2 Flat And A Duplex

Once youre in the market for a multi-family, youll hear terms like 2 flat and duplex thrown around a lot. While the two words are similar, they dont mean the same thing when referring to Chicago properties, so its important to learn the difference.

The word duplex refers to a building with two units, but it doesnt mean that both units are considered parts of the same property. A duplex in Chicago can be a building with two townhomes or condos that are separately owned and financed. To keep everything straight, we like to refer to two-unit properties as two-flats. Make sure to make it clear to your realtor which type of property youre interested in to avoid confusion!

What Are The Cons Of Investing In Multi

Buying a multi-family and making profit from rental income sounds like the dream, and while it can be very beneficial, its worth noting that it takes work as well. Youll be responsible for maintenance in all units, collecting rent payments, and finding new tenants when the time arises. To stay on top of your finances, you will want to save portions of rental income and schedule contractor work for parts of the house that need updating. Youll also have to keep track of landscaping and mediate tenant conflicts when they arise.

Its possible to get a property manager, but this also takes time and funds that otherwise go to you. While a multi-family is a good investment, it does add work to your days and isnt the right investment choice for everyone.

Isnt It Better To Buy A Building With Units That Are Fully Rented

It depends on your investment strategy, but oftentimes, no! Its great to have rented units since it guarantees rental income until the end of the lease agreements, but as with any benefit, theres a flipside. If all units are rented more than sixty days after close, you wont be able to live in one of the units to claim owner occupancy, which prevents financing options like the FHA or VA loan. If youre hoping to live in your building, make sure to request copies of any lease agreements to confirm that at least one unit will become vacant soon after your closing date.

Renovate And Make Repairs

Before you open your doors to the public, youll need to make any repairs detailed in your inspection report and ensure that your multifamily home follows local codes.

You may also want to invest in some cosmetic upgrades, like new doorknobs, light fixtures, cabinet pulls, and a fresh coat of paint. Bear in mind that you might find youre able to attract more tenants or even increase your rent not to mention overall net operating income with the help of these upgrades.

Be sure you have a maintenance plan in place as well. This plan should handle any tenant repair requests and regular upkeep of the building as well as lawn care and snow removal.

When purchasing a single-family home, theres a lot to consider:

Youre tenant dependent. Youll be locked into a more limited income stream when your sole renter is your single source of income, and a vacancy of the home results in total loss of revenue.

Single-family homes can draw long-term tenants. Rental homes in neighborhoods with good schools, local parks and easy access to shopping areas are a good fit for renters that are ready to settle down and sign a multi-year lease.

Better short-term benefit. Homes offer a better exit strategy. Unlike owner-occupied dwellings, investing in a single-family home can out-perform the financial gains made by multi-family properties in the near-term because the home usually appreciates in value more quickly.

Insurance for single-family homes is cheaper. Because the value of the propertys less, so will your cost for insuring the space. Regardless of the landlords insurance policy you purchase for the space, keep in mind that your tenants items will not be covered by this policy. Its important to either have a clause in your lease strongly encouraging or requiring them to get renters insurance. Check with your state and local codes to determine which action is right for your area.
